Fabrication and Properties of WC-Al2O3 Cemented Carbide Reinforced by Single-Walled Carbon Nanotubes

Abstract:

WCAl2O3-Carbon nanotubes (CNTs) composites were prepared by hot pressing process. Effects of trace amount of CNTs additives on the microstructure and mechanical properties of the WCAl2O3 were investigated. The microstructure, phase identification and hardness of composites were analyzed by using optical microscopy, X-ray diffraction (XRD) and Vickers indenter. The experimental results indicate that both the WCAl2O3 doped with 0.1wt% CNTs and 0.5wt%CNTs possessed the refined microstructure and enhanced mechanical properties compared with that of the WCAl2O3 doped with 1wt% and 1.5wt% CNTs. When CNTs were added to the WC-Al2O3 composites, the decarburization suppression could be achieved in the WC-Al2O3 powders system.
